Hello from Switch Tasmania and our NEW Executive Officer - ALI UREN!
|
|
It is with a lot of excitement, that I formally commence as Executive Officer of Switch Tasmania as of the 1st July 2021.
The last month has been focused on our handover and I would like to say a big
|
THANK YOU to Jodhi Gough, for being generous and thorough in time and knowledge to ensure success in the role and for Switch and our business community.
|
I come to the Switch role with over 15 years in the business and career innovation space and look forward to continuing to work with community to build talent and confidence within the digital skills space.
|
A focus moving forward will also be continuing to deliver new ways in making quality connections with other business across the North-West, so please keep across these events over the coming 18 months.
|
These events will involve new ways to access some new insights, while having the conversations that lead to opportunities, that you cannot get sitting on the couch or working from the home office.
|
It took over six years to finally make the move to Tasmania and after looking for suitable property across the State, the decision was made to make our home in North West Tasmania.
|
After selling our farm in Barossa, South Australia, late 2020 we moved ourselves and some belongings (whatever could fit into two cars) to Devonport. The move was hard fought in a pandemic but we are very excited to be part of the community and are confident it was a great move.

BUSINESS NORTH WEST NEWS:
|
Using the Renew Australia model, Renew Burnie will offer emerging creative businesses RENT FREE access to vacant commercial spaces in the CBD, to support their business evolution and in return help create a more vibrant and culturally diverse CBD....
